First, consider our Vaughnsville setting. A great local facility will know how to handle the excitement of a puppy alongside the calmer energy of older farm dogs or hunting breeds common in our region. They should have secure, spacious outdoor areas for play that are safe from our rural traffic and wildlife. Ask about their protocol for our variable Ohio weather—how do they keep pups comfortable during a sudden summer thunderstorm or a chilly, damp fall day? A good boarder will have plans for both indoor enrichment and safe outdoor time.
When touring potential spots, don't just look at the space; ask about the routine. Puppies thrive on consistency. What's the daily schedule for feeding, potty breaks, and play? How do they handle the extra potty training support a young pup might need? Mention if your dog is used to the sounds of tractors or livestock, as this can help the staff make them feel at ease. Preparing your puppy is key. Ensure all vaccinations are up-to-date, a must for any reputable boarding facility. Pack familiar items: their own food to avoid stomach upset, a beloved blanket that smells like home, and a durable chew toy. Provide clear written instructions and your vet's contact info. A trial daycare stay can work wonders to ease first-time jitters for both of you.
